- Uses the `unless-stopped` restart policy to make sure the Caddy container is restarted automatically when your machine is rebooted.
- Binds to ports `80` and `443` for HTTP and HTTPS respectively, plus `443/udp` for HTTP/3.
- Bind mounts the `Caddyfile` file which is your Caddy configuration.
- Bind mounts the `conf` directory which contains your Caddyfile configuration.
- Bind mounts the `site` directory to serve your site's static files from `/srv`.
- Named volumes for `/data` and `/config` to [persist important information](/docs/conventions#file-locations).
